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.08.21;
Скачать: CL | DM;

Вниз

Как из скрипта заставить перекомпилиться пакет   Найти похожие ветки 

 
aleman   (2003-07-29 13:14) [0]

БД Oracle. Из скрипта изменяется один пакет, а перекомпилить нужно несколько. Что нужно написать, чтобы из скрипта заставить перекомпилиться пакет?


 
VAleksey ©   (2003-07-29 13:59) [1]

А смысл?
1) Оракл перекопилирует пакеты по мере обращения.
2)
select * from User_objects
where (Object_type = "PACKAGE" or Object_type = "PACKAGE BODY" or .. <соответственно процедуры и функции>)
and
not STATUS = "VALID"
Вот такой запросик тебе вернет все объекты которые надо перекомпилировать
Потом используешь для каждого команду
alter function <То что нужно перекомпилировать находится в поле Oblect_Name> compile;



Страницы: 1 вся ветка

Текущий архив: 2003.08.21;
Скачать: CL | DM;

Наверх




Память: 0.46 MB
Время: 0.013 c
14-68450
MalkoLinge
2003-08-04 13:32
2003.08.21
Вот башни, которые грохнул Буш


4-68588
Борис К.
2003-06-18 11:17
2003.08.21
Проблема с ProgressBar и копированием файлов под XP...


4-68591
bitman
2003-06-18 14:32
2003.08.21
измение фонта меню


14-68507
HolACost_
2003-08-05 16:35
2003.08.21
UU, XX, Base64


3-68212
Magic&Wizard
2003-07-24 20:41
2003.08.21
КАК отловить, что запись в базе уже СУЩЕСТВУЕТ